First Jason covers Coinbase CEO Brian Armstrong's reflections on last year's blog "Coinbase is a mission focused company.” Then, Nat Manning joins from Kettle, to chat about better assessing fire risk with data, how California can prevent home damage from increasing wildfires, outperforming actuaries & more.
